Understanding the Mechanics of the Ascent
At its heart, the aviator game simulates an airplane’s flight, with the height reached by the plane dictating the payout multiplier. The round begins with a small multiplier, typically 1x, which incrementally increases as the plane gains altitude. Players set their initial bet and choose when to “cash out,” locking in the corresponding multiplier. The longer you wait, the higher the multiplier, but the greater the risk of the plane flying away before you can claim your winnings.
This simple mechanic creates a dynamic and engaging experience. Players need to constantly assess their risk tolerance and make quick decisions. A key aspect is understanding the concept of the “crash.” At any given moment during the flight, the plane can suddenly disappear from the screen, resulting in a lost bet for anyone who hasn’t cashed out. This unpredictability is what makes the game so addictive and exciting. The game often includes features like automatic cash-out options and the ability to view the history of previous flights to help develop strategies.

Developing a Successful Strategy
While the aviator game is largely based on chance, implementing a sound strategy can significantly improve your chances of success. One popular approach is to use a conservative strategy, consistently cashing out at relatively low multipliers, like 1.5x to 2x. This minimizes risk and provides a steady stream of small wins. Another strategy involves setting a target multiplier and sticking to it, regardless of how high the plane flies.
More advanced techniques include using the Martingale system, where you double your bet after each loss in an attempt to recoup your losses and make a profit. However, the Martingale system can be risky as it requires a substantial bankroll and can lead to significant losses if you experience a prolonged losing streak. Analyzing previous flight data can also be helpful, looking for patterns and trends, although it’s important to remember that each round is independent and past performance is not indicative of future results.

Managing Your Bankroll Effectively
Effective bankroll management is crucial for long-term success in the aviator game. Determine a fixed amount of money that you are comfortable losing, and never exceed this limit. Divide your bankroll into smaller units and wager only a small percentage of your bankroll on each round. This helps to minimize the impact of losing streaks and extend your playing time. A common recommendation is to wager no more than 1-5% of your bankroll per bet.
Avoid the temptation to chase losses by increasing your bet size after a losing streak. This is a common mistake that can quickly deplete your bankroll. Instead, stick to your predetermined betting strategy and remain disciplined. Remember that the aviator game is designed to be entertaining, and it should not be viewed as a guaranteed source of income. Proper planning and risk assessment can make all the difference.

The Psychology of the Aviator Game
The aviator game’s captivating nature owes much to its mastery of psychological triggers. The escalating multiplier creates a sense of anticipation and excitement, encouraging players to push their luck. The fear of missing out (FOMO) can also play a significant role, leading players to delay cashing out in the hope of reaching a higher multiplier. This is compounded by the visual representation of the plane’s ascent, solidifying this anticipation.
It’s important to be aware of these psychological factors and avoid making impulsive decisions based on emotion. Maintain a rational mindset and stick to your predetermined strategy. Remember that the game is designed to be addictive, and it’s easy to get caught up in the thrill of the chase. Recognizing these tendencies is a vital step toward responsible gameplay and enjoying the game in a controlled manner.
